Two questions inside one trial
Not every treatment study asks whether to add something. Some ask whether fewer doses, less surgery, shorter radiation, or a planned stopping point can work as well.
When they do, they are answering two questions at once. Did cancer control hold? And did life during or after treatment actually improve?
Those questions need different measurements. A trial that reports only the first has answered half its own question.

Quality of life has to be measured, not assumed
It is easy to state that less treatment must feel better. It is not always true. Fewer visits can mean more anxiety about whether enough was done. A shorter drug course can shift side effects rather than remove them.
The only way to know is to ask patients directly, with a validated tool, at set time points. NCI defines a patient-reported outcome as information about a person's health that comes directly from the patient. Examples include a description of symptoms, satisfaction with care, and how a disease or treatment affects physical, mental, emotional, and social well-being.
The phrase "directly from the patient" is the point. A clinician's impression of how someone is doing is a different measurement. The two often disagree.
The core set FDA asks sponsors to collect
FDA issued final guidance in October 2024 on core patient-reported outcomes in cancer clinical trials. It came from the agency's Oncology Center of Excellence, with the drug and biologics centers.
The guidance identifies a core set of concepts:
- Disease-related symptoms.
- Symptomatic adverse events.
- An overall side effect impact summary measure.
- Physical function.
- Role function.
FDA suggests measuring cardinal disease symptoms with a symptom scale where one exists. Where symptoms vary widely, it points to items patients consistently report as important across advanced cancer, such as pain, appetite loss, and fatigue.
The guidance also warns against collecting too much. Extra questionnaires add burden and can lower data quality. Additional outcomes should be chosen deliberately, and specified in advance.
Note the scope. This guidance addresses trials of anti-cancer therapies meant to affect survival, tumor response, or progression. It is not written for supportive care drugs.
Missing surveys are not missing at random
This is the quiet flaw in patient-reported data, and it points in one direction.
People who feel worst are the least likely to fill out a questionnaire. Someone hospitalized, in severe pain, or too tired to complete a form drops out of the data. What remains is the experience of people doing relatively well.
A trial that reports strong quality-of-life results with 40% of surveys missing has not shown what it appears to show. Good reports state the completion rate at each time point and test whether the conclusion survives different assumptions about the missing responses.
Reading a trial that reports both outcomes
- Were cancer-control and quality-of-life goals both defined before the trial started?
- Which instrument was used, and at which time points?
- What was the survey completion rate, and did it fall over time?
- Were the reported differences large enough for patients to notice?
- Did any improvement persist after treatment ended?
Late effects are often the reason for reducing treatment in the first place. That makes longer follow-up necessary, not optional. Our guide to what clinical trials are explains how these designs are built.
What a comfort gain cannot buy
- Less treatment is not safer for every cancer or risk group.
- Fewer side effects do not compensate for worse cancer control unless patients understand and accept that tradeoff.
- A trial strategy should not be copied outside of medical care.
- An average improvement across a group does not describe any one person's experience.

Prevention and risk reduction
Not every cancer can be prevented. Avoiding tobacco, protecting skin from ultraviolet radiation, limiting alcohol, staying active, and receiving recommended HPV or hepatitis B vaccination can lower the risk of certain cancers. A risk factor is not a prediction or a cause in one individual.
Symptoms and possible early signs
Possible signs vary and are often caused by conditions other than cancer. Changes worth discussing include a new lump, unexplained bleeding or weight loss, a persistent cough, lasting bowel or bladder changes, a changing skin spot, or symptoms that persist or worsen. Some early cancers cause no symptoms.
Screening and early detection
Screening looks for certain cancers before symptoms begin. Recommended tests exist only for some cancers and depend on age and risk. Screening can have benefits and harms; it is not the same as evaluating a new symptom, and there is no single routine scan or blood test that reliably screens for every cancer.
How cancer is diagnosed
Diagnosis may involve a history and exam, imaging, laboratory tests, and often a biopsy. Pathology can identify the cancer type and may test biomarkers that guide treatment. Symptoms, screening results, tumor markers, or online stories alone cannot confirm cancer.
